Plum"] version_count: 3 action_count: 26 vote_count: 8 first_action: "2021-01-15" last_action: "2021-03-18" source: "openstates" source_identifier: "ocd-bill/2b67b84e-84a3-4c98-acb8-72de01b27b02" source_url: "https://lis.virginia.gov/cgi-bin/legp604.exe?212+sum+HB2290" source_hash: "456e48fd4aa42f16d77117107c1e53625c6de21d2aa214f2fa72edced0802886" vintage: "2026-07-01" source_snapshot: "https://data.openstates.org/daily/2026-07-01/public.pgdump" retrieved_at: "2026-07-06" confidence: "reported" tags: ["legislation", "bill", "us-va"] --- # Virginia HB 2290 (2021) — Larceny; repeals punishment for conviction of second or subsequent misdemeanor. Punishment for conviction of second or subsequent misdemeanor larceny; repeal. Repeals the enhanced penalties fora second or subsequent misdemeanor larceny conviction. Under currentlaw, when a person is convicted of a second larceny offense, he shallbe confined in jail not less than 30 days nor more than 12 months,and for a third, or any subsequent offense, he shall be guilty ofa Class 6 felony. ## Version chain The bill's text revisions, in order — the diff chain from filing to enrollment. 1. **CHAP0192** (committee substitute) — [source](https://lis.virginia.gov/cgi-bin/legp604.exe?212+ful+CHAP0192) 2. **HB2290ER** (committee substitute) — [source](https://lis.virginia.gov/cgi-bin/legp604.exe?212+ful+HB2290ER) 3. **Presented and ordered printed 21101450D** (committee substitute) — [source](https://lis.virginia.gov/cgi-bin/legp604.exe?212+ful+HB2290) ## Votes - Subcommittee recommends reporting (5-Y 3-N) — **5–3** (pass) · lower - Passed Senate (21-Y 18-N) — **21–18** (pass) · upper - Subcommittee recommends reporting (5-Y 3-N) — **5–3** (pass) · lower - Reported from Courts of Justice (13-Y 9-N) — **13–9** (pass) · lower - Constitutional reading dispensed (39-Y 0-N) — **39–0** (pass) · upper - Continued to 2021 Sp.
